9
Q

Stomata

A
2
Controls respiration and transpiration
Controlled by guard cells (epidermal)
More on leaf underside
Found in non-vascular plants
Turgid GC=open
Flaccid GC=closed

11
Q

Tracheids

A

5
Dead at maturity (associated withy xylem)
Lignin deposits in cell walls (secondary cell wall)
No perforations
Closely packed, elongated cells
